What Are the Key Features to Look for in the Best Scooter Suitcases for Kids?

The best scooter suitcases for kids should combine functionality, safety, and fun elements to create an enjoyable travel experience.

  • Durability: Look for materials that can withstand rough handling and daily use, such as high-quality plastics or fabrics. A durable suitcase will last longer and protect the contents inside from damage.
  • Weight Capacity: Ensure that the scooter suitcase can support a reasonable weight, accommodating not just the child’s belongings but also their weight when riding. A higher weight capacity allows for more items to be packed without compromising safety.
  • Safety Features: Features like a stable base, anti-slip grips on the scooter, and reflective elements for visibility are essential. These ensure that the child can ride safely and be seen in low-light conditions.
  • Adjustable Handle: An adjustable handle allows the suitcase to adapt to different heights, making it comfortable for children of varying ages. This feature promotes better posture and control while riding the scooter.
  • Storage Space: Adequate storage compartments can help organize items, making it easier for kids to find their belongings. Look for suitcases with separate sections or pockets to keep clothing, toys, and other essentials tidy.
  • Design and Style: Fun and engaging designs can make traveling more exciting for kids. Choose a suitcase that features their favorite characters or colors, which can encourage them to take responsibility for their luggage.
  • Easy Maneuverability: Consider how well the scooter suitcase can turn and glide on different surfaces. Smooth-rolling wheels and a sturdy scooter base contribute to an enjoyable riding experience.

What Safety Considerations Should Be Made When Selecting a Scooter Suitcase for Kids?

When selecting a scooter suitcase for kids, several safety considerations should be taken into account to ensure a safe and enjoyable experience.

  • Stability: The suitcase should have a wide base and a low center of gravity to prevent tipping over when in use. Stability is crucial, especially for younger children who may not have strong balance skills.
  • Weight Limit: Check the manufacturer’s specified weight limit for the scooter suitcase to ensure it can safely support the child’s weight. Overloading the suitcase can lead to accidents or damage to the scooter mechanism.
  • Material Durability: Opt for suitcases made from durable, impact-resistant materials that can withstand rough handling. This not only increases the lifespan of the suitcase but also minimizes the risk of sharp edges or breakage that could harm the child.
  • Brake Functionality: A reliable braking system is essential for safety. Ensure the suitcase has an easily accessible brake that can be engaged to prevent rolling when the child is getting on or off the scooter.
  • Handle Height Adjustment: Look for adjustable handles that can accommodate a range of heights as children grow. This feature not only promotes comfort but also ensures that the child can maintain control while riding.
  • Reflective Elements: Consider scooter suitcases with reflective strips or colors for visibility, especially if used in low-light conditions. Increased visibility can help prevent accidents by making the child more noticeable to others.
  • Non-Toxic Materials: Ensure that the suitcase is made from non-toxic, child-safe materials to avoid health risks. Many manufacturers offer products that are free from harmful chemicals, which is important for children’s safety.
  • Easy Maneuverability: The scooter should allow for smooth and easy maneuverability, which reduces the likelihood of falls or crashes. Check the wheels for quality and ensure they can handle different surfaces without getting stuck or creating a hazard.

The price range for high-quality scooter suitcases for kids typically falls between $80 and $200. Factors influencing this cost include brand reputation, material quality, and additional features such as LED lights or built-in speakers. Brands like Trunki and Scooter Luggage are well-known for offering reliable options within this price range, with various styles and functionalities tailored to different age groups.
